Quarterly Planning Note — FY Headcount

For the incoming director: next year's plan adds eleven roles across the Larkspur engineering group and trims four in field operations. Backfill freezes lift in Q2. Contractor conversion at the Wrenfield site proceeds as scoped, pending finance sign-off. Detailed role matrices are in the planning folder. Please absorb the sensitive context provided immediately below.

internal memo for kawip-hadug: Headcount on the Wenwyn team goes from 7 to 140 by the end of January. Gross margin on Wenwyn came in at 20 percent against a plan of 15 percent.

Present: T. Ashwin (chair), R. Colvey, M. Strand, P. Innes.

1. The overhaul of the Lumen Rewards programme was approved in principle. Tier thresholds will be simplified from five to three, and point expiry extended to 24 months.
2. Marketing presented migration messaging; rollout targeted for autumn.
3. Finance confirmed the liability impact is within tolerance, pending audit sign-off.
4. Ops to scope systems changes with the Helford platform team.

The commercial reasoning reserved for the board is recorded below.

management briefing: The renewal with Quenaelox Group closes at $2 million a year, 15 percent below the last contract. Project Holwyn slips by six weeks because of the tooling delay.

## Authentication

The Siftgate bloom filter sits in front of the Pebblestore key-value service and rejects lookups for keys that were never written, sparing the backend. Support staff querying Siftgate directly must authenticate every request; anonymous calls return 403 regardless of the key queried. Tokens are scoped read-only and expire after ninety days, so check the issue date before debugging auth failures. For the shared support tooling, use the following Siftgate API key.

API key for yahig-tadup: kto7_ubizbYm